摘要
鞋靴的舒适性与足底和鞋垫各方面的匹配性关联密切,鞋垫作为鞋靴中与足部直接接触的部分,其结构和硬度是改善鞋靴舒适性的关键。对此,简要分析与总结了鞋靴舒适性的影响因素,从局部缓冲型鞋垫和整体定制型鞋垫两方面探究了不同鞋垫结构下足底压力分布变化,并设计了硬质鞋垫、软质鞋垫和无鞋垫情况下鞋靴的舒适性试验。通过运动状态下人体的稳定性与鞋靴的减震性参数来体现鞋靴的舒适性,以期为改善足底受力状态、提升鞋靴穿着者的足部舒适性提供参考。
The comfort of shoes and boots is closely related to the matching of the soles and insoles.As the part of shoes and boots that directly contacts the foot, the structure and hardness of insoles are the key to improve the comfort of shoes and boots.In this regard, the influencing factors of the comfort of shoes and boots were briefly analyzed and summarized.The pressure distribution changes of the soles under different insole structures were explored from the two aspects of local cushioning insoles and overall customized insoles, and the comfort tests of shoes and boots under the conditions of hard insoles, soft insoles and no insoles were designed.The comfort of shoes and boots is reflected by the stability of the human body and the shock absorption parameters of shoes and boots in the exercise state, so as to provide reference for improving the stress state of the sole and improving the foot comfort of the wearer of shoes and boots.
